Grasping Registered Agent Requirements

To establish a company such as an LLC or incorporated entity, appointing a designated representative is a key aspect subject to defined criteria. A designated representative functions as a official representative for managing official papers, alerts, and additional formal correspondence on in representation of the company. Most states require that every business entity have a registered agent, which helps to confirm that there is someone available to handle essential legal notifications alerts. This requirement is in place to maintain open lines of communication between companies and the state.

Legal representative requirements can vary by region, but generally, an human or a business entity can serve in this capacity. People must be at least 18 years old and live in the region where the business is created. If utilizing a legal services firm, it must be licensed to perform business in that jurisdiction and maintain a real address for handling legal documents.  registered agent California , also known as the designated office, cannot be a P.O. box, as it must enable for in-person deliveries.

When selecting a legal agent, entities should take into account not only adherence with local laws but also the reliability and sufficiency of the representative. It is essential to make sure that the registered agent is available during business hours to accept important notices. Registered Agent Costs and Fees

When considering registered agent services, understanding the pricing and costs associated with these companies is crucial for entrepreneurs. The pricing structure can vary widely based on the type of service, the area, and the specific registered agent company. Generally, typical charges can range from 50 to 300 dollars annually, depending on the provided services. It is essential to evaluate what is part of these fees; some registration agents may combine offerings like compliance notifications and management of business correspondence, while others may charge further fees for these features.
